Instructions. Place yeast, water, sugar, and salt in bowl and stir until dissolved. Add flour and stir until well blended. Do not knead. Cover and let rise until double in size (about 1 hour). Remove dough from bowl and place in 2 rounds on a greased cookie sheet sprinkled with cornmeal. Let rise an additional hour.

In a sufficiently deep steel bowl add the flour and salt and mix it well. Keep aside. Make lukewarm water. If the water is warmer than lukewarm you'll end up killing the yeast. One trick to get the perfect lukewarm water is to mix ½ cup boiling water to 1.5 cups normal cool water. The mixture is the perfect lukewarm.

Ingredients. 3 cups (384 g) bread flour or all-purpose flour. 1 1/2 teaspoons (5 g) instant yeast, see notes if using active dry. 1 1/2 teaspoons (7 g) sugar. 1 1/2 teaspoons (5 g) kosher salt. 1 1/2 cups (340 grams) lukewarm water. Softened butter. 1 tablespoon olive oil.
